1.如何不使用遍历把字符串数组转换成数字数组
2.举个例子 : ['1','2','3']=>[1,2,3] 有没有什么新技术
不用遍历,那只能用老技术了..
let arr = JSON.parse('[' + String(['1', '2', '3']) + ']')
console.log(arr) // [1, 2, 3]
经 @pommy 提醒,换成 JSON.parse
了,JSON.parse
比 eval
更安全
10 回答11.3k 阅读
5 回答4.9k 阅读✓ 已解决
4 回答3.2k 阅读✓ 已解决
2 回答2.8k 阅读✓ 已解决
3 回答2.5k 阅读✓ 已解决
3 回答2.2k 阅读✓ 已解决
2 回答2.7k 阅读✓ 已解决
['1','2','3'].map(Number)